Jaguars cinch 49-19 win for Homecoming
PHOTO BY URSULA ROGERS The Johnson High School Jaguars faced the San Marcos High School Rattlers in their first district matchup of the season as they celebrated Homecoming. The Jaguars took down the Rattlers with a score of 49-19. Pictured, Jaguar Charles Steward (No. 33) tackles a Rattler.

PHOTO BY URSULA ROGERS A member of the Johnson Jaguar Band pit performs the band’s 2024 show Planet Disco, which takes inspiration from the Gustav Holst masterpiece “Planets” and mixes it with Disco classic hits.

PHOTO BY URSULA ROGERS Jaguar Kael Hatnot (No. 20) runs the ball while attempting to speed past Rattlers. The Jaguars will face the Canyon High School Cougars in New Braunfels on Friday, Oct. 4.

PHOTO BY URSULA ROGERS Johnson High School Homecoming King Mason Stock (No. 75) and Queen Kaylee Rivera smile after being crowned.
